Ken,
AFAICS, some hdparm -t or dbench 1 will reveal slight variations
between 2.4 & 2.6 ... In some cases 2.4 will be better.
Running dbench 10 we have :
2.6
202 48.57
234 22.28
234 16.00
234 12.48
234 10.23
234 8.66
234 7.52
431 12.37
463 11.86
464 10.76
2.4.21
119 15.06
151 10.75
282 15.54
301 13.44
313 11.84
352 11.49
360 10.38
360 9.29
360 8.42
Here's what we can call a server direction.2.6 is unbeatable there due
to IO scheduler (i.e. As-iosched, cfq and noop rock'n'roll)
There are no good conclusions at all although ,at this state of
development, IMHO, 2.4 seems more 'client friendly' and 2.6 server
oriented in this chapter.
